Village Banking

What is Village Banking?

Village Banking is a way for people who know and trust each other — friends, coworkers, or family — to save and borrow money together without a traditional bank. Members contribute to a shared pool, take out loans, and share the interest earned.

What are the benefits of Village Banking?

It's flexible, community-driven, and built on trust. You get access to savings and credit without relying on banks or expensive lenders — just your group.

Loan & Transaction Features

How often can I transact (save, borrow, repay)?

As often as your group allows — the app lets you transact whenever. Most groups run weekly or monthly.

How much can I borrow?

It depends on your group balance and rules. Your loan entitlement is a multiple of your current balance at the time of borrowing, and that multiple is set in your group rules.

Can I take multiple loans?

No. You can only have one loan running at a time.

When do I repay my loan?

Your group sets the repayment dates. The app then generates a schedule of equal instalments and sends reminders before each due date.

What happens if someone defaults?

Penalties are set by the group at creation. Bevura tracks loan repayments and notifies the group of defaults.

Are loans instant?

If you qualify and the admin approves your loan, the funds are placed in your Bevura wallet instantly.
